Jump the config processing.
- Dockerfile_x86 is the mediawiki on x86
- Dockerfile_arm is the mediawiki on arm
- Dockerfile is the same as Dockerfile_x86.
$ docker build -t dorry-mediawiki -f Dockerfile_x86 .
or
$ docker build -t dorry-mediawiki .
$ docker build -t dorry-mediawiki -f Dockerfile_arm .
- SERVER_ADDR server mediawiki service address, e.g.,http://test-a:9000
- DB_SERVER_IP database ip. e.g., 172.17.0.2
- DB_USER database user. e.g., root
- DB_PASSWORD database user password. e.g., abc123_
$ docker run -itd --name dorry-mediawiki -p 9000:9000 --link mysql:mysql --privileged dorry-mediawiki
Enter mysql container,
mysql -uroot -pxxx
UPDATE user SET user_password = md5(CONCAT('1-',md5('abc123_'))) WHERE user_id=1;